Learning Outcomes |
Competences |
- Students have an overview of medical devices in the areas covered in the course. They know the medical background in anatomy, physiology and pathology as well as the physical and technical principles of the function of the medical devices covered.
- Based on the overview and detailed knowledge, students can understand the functions of the medical devices and evaluate and assess the applications, risks and limitations of the medical devices.
|
|
Skills |
Knowledge |
- Explain the function of medical devices based on physical principles. (k1-k3)
- Evaluate medical devices depending on the expected compliance of patients (k1-k5).
- Assess the risks of operating medical devices. (k1-k4)
|
- Functional and anatomical basics of the respiratory system
- Diagnostic and therapeutic devices of the respiratory system
- Functional and anatomical basics of the visual system
- Diagnostic and therapeutic devices of the visual system
- Functional and anatomical basics of the auditory and vestibular system
- Diagnostic and therapeutic devices of the auditory and vestibular system
- Functional and anatomical basics of the central nervous system
- Diagnostic and therapeutic devices of the central nervous system
- Imaging using magnetic resonance imaging (MRI)
- Endoscopy
- Laser applications in medicine
